Python是一种高级编程语言,以其简洁、易读、易写的语法和丰富的库而著称。以下是对Python高级编程特点的概述:
易学易用:
Python的语法清晰,采用缩进来表示代码块,使得代码结构直观易懂。
丰富的库和框架:
Python拥有庞大的标准库和第三方库,如NumPy、Pandas、Matplotlib、Django、Flask、TensorFlow和PyTorch等,覆盖了从数据科学到Web开发等多个领域。
跨平台性:
Python可以在多种操作系统上运行,包括Windows、macOS、Linux等,便于开发者跨平台开发。
面向对象编程:
支持面向对象编程范式,有助于代码的组织和封装,提高代码的可重用性和可维护性。
可扩展性和可嵌入性:
可以使用C或C++编写扩展模块来提高性能,也可以将Python嵌入到其他应用程序中。
广泛的应用领域:
Python在Web开发、数据科学、人工智能、自动化测试等领域有着广泛的应用。
开源和免费:
Python是一种纯自由软件,有着庞大的开源社区支持。
敏捷开发支持:
《Python高级编程》等书籍提供了关于敏捷开发、持续集成、版本控制等高级主题的实践和建议。
Python的高级编程特性和应用使其成为初学者和专业开发者的热门选择。它简化了编程任务,提高了开发效率,并且有着强大的社区支持和丰富的资源,是学习和使用编程的极佳选择